Address

0xEB718742c092D4a1e3DCe3d6D3a4b9EC36837105

0.917148379287231 ETH
1765.78 USD

Confirmed
Balance0.917148379287231 ETH1765.78 USD
Transactions50
Non-contract Transactions49
Internal Transactions0
Nonce18
ContractTokensTransfers#
pstETH.org1 claim rewards on pstETH.org of ID 01